Visual identity created for Air Montenegro, the national flag carrier launched in 2021. In an airline context, the mark has to work with more discipline than a typical logo: on aircraft tails, boarding documents, airport wayfinding and small digital surfaces. The symbol succeeds because it can be read as a wing, a route and an abstract bird in one motion, giving the brand national character without sacrificing speed, clarity or technical precision.
From a design standpoint, Air Montenegro works best when the mark stays disciplined: clear silhouette, stable proportion and enough restraint to survive different scales and surfaces. The real value is not ornament, but recognisability under pressure, whether the identity sits in a header, on printed material, in signage or inside a tighter digital layout.
That balance is especially important in aviation, where trust and repetition matter as much as visual distinctiveness. A good airline identity has to feel durable over time, and this direction is strongest precisely because it is simple enough to travel.
